    What is a Monthly Profit & Loss Forecast Report ? A Monthly Profit & Loss Forecast Report is a planning tool used by CFOs and planning managers to anticipate and plan activities based on revenues, expenses, and profitability. It provides a detailed month-by-month overview of revenues and expenses at a GL account level, including year-to-date actual figures and forecasts for the remaining months. The Profit & Loss forecast is linked to the Balance Sheet and Cash Flow Forecast. Here is an example of this forecast template. Where Does the Data for Analysis Originate From? The Actual (historical transactions) data typically comes from enterprise resource planning (ERP) systems like: Microsoft Dynamics 365 (D365) Finance,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business Central (D365 BC), Microsoft Dynamics AX, Microsoft Dynamics NAV, Microsoft Dynamics GP, Microsoft Dynamics SL, Sage Intacct, Sage 100, Sage 300, Sage 500, Sage X3, SAP Business One, SAP ByDesign, Netsuite and others. In analyses where budgets or forecasts are used, the planning data most often originates from in-house Excel spreadsheet models or from professional corporate performance management (CPM/EPM) solutions. What Tools are Typically used for Reporting, Planning and Dashboards? Examples of business software used with the data and ERPs mentioned above are:
    • Native ERP report writers and query tools
    • Spreadsheets (for example Microsoft Excel)
    • Corporate Performance Management (CPM) tools (for example Solver)
    • Dashboards (for example Microsoft Power BI and Tableau)
